视频库环境配置与iframe自动播放处理
需积分: 5 140 浏览量
更新于2024-11-27
收藏 17.27MB ZIP 举报
资源摘要信息:"MS3_VideoLibrary"是一个涉及多个知识点的IT专业术语。首先,从标题来看,它可能是一个视频库项目的名称,例如一个基于网络的视频共享服务或者内部视频资源管理系统。其次,描述部分提供了关于env.py文件的一些关键配置信息,这些配置通常用于Web应用的环境变量设置。此外,描述中还提到了HTML的iframe标签及一个与视频自动播放相关的属性设置。以下是对这些知识点的详细说明:
1. env.py文件的作用和内容解析:
env.py文件通常用于设置Python应用的环境变量,这些变量可能包含数据库连接信息、应用配置等。在这个描述中,env.py文件设置了五个环境变量:
- IP:这是应用运行的IP地址,这里是"*.*.*.*",表示应用将绑定到所有可用的IP地址上。
- PORT:这是应用监听的端口号,这里是"5000",意味着应用将通过5000端口提供服务。
- SECRET_KEY:这是一个用于确保应用安全性的重要变量,通常用于防止CSRF攻击,生成哈希值等安全措施。这里的值是一个看似随机的字符串,应该保密。
- MONGO_URI:这是MongoDB数据库的连接字符串,包含了服务器地址、用户名、密码、数据库名、是否重试写操作以及写操作的确认级别。其中"mongodb +srv"是MongoDB Atlas提供的连接字符串格式,用于连接托管在MongoDB Atlas上的数据库。
- MONGO_DBNAME:这是数据库的名称,在这里是"videolibrary"。
2. HTML的iframe标签和"allow"属性:
iframe标签是HTML中的一个内联框架元素,允许在一个文档中嵌入另一个独立的文档(通常是另一个HTML页面)。这在需要从外部资源嵌入内容时非常有用,比如视频、地图等。
描述中提到了"iframe allow"类,但没有提供具体的上下文信息。不过,通常情况下,"allow"属性用于指定允许跨源请求的特性列表。由于Web安全策略,出于安全考虑,浏览器限制了跨源资源共享(CORS)。所以,如果iframe中嵌入的内容是从其他域加载的,可能需要在"allow"属性中指定允许的特性,以便内容能够正常工作。
描述中还提到了需要从"allow"类中删除"自动播放"属性。这通常意味着在某个应用中,开发者可能希望控制视频的播放行为,而不是让视频在每次页面加载时自动播放。这可以通过修改iframe标签的属性来实现,或者通过JavaScript来控制视频播放。
总结以上内容,MS3_VideoLibrary描述了一个视频库应用的配置环境,并指出了在使用iframe标签嵌入视频内容时需要注意的一些细节,特别是在控制视频播放行为和确保Web应用安全方面。这些知识点对于Web开发人员来说是非常重要的,涉及到Web应用的部署、配置以及前端开发的实践。
2021-10-03 上传
2017-04-16 上传
2022-09-23 上传
2021-09-30 上传
2022-09-24 上传
2022-09-21 上传
2022-09-24 上传
蓝色山脉
- 粉丝: 21
- 资源: 4613
最新资源
- Raspberry Pi OpenCL驱动程序安装与QEMU仿真指南
- Apache RocketMQ Go客户端:全面支持与消息处理功能
- WStage平台:无线传感器网络阶段数据交互技术
- 基于Java SpringBoot和微信小程序的ssm智能仓储系统开发
- CorrectMe项目:自动更正与建议API的开发与应用
- IdeaBiz请求处理程序JAVA:自动化API调用与令牌管理
- 墨西哥面包店研讨会:介绍关键业绩指标(KPI)与评估标准
- 2014年Android音乐播放器源码学习分享
- CleverRecyclerView扩展库:滑动效果与特性增强
- 利用Python和SURF特征识别斑点猫图像
- Wurpr开源PHP MySQL包装器:安全易用且高效
- Scratch少儿编程:Kanon妹系闹钟音效素材包
- 食品分享社交应用的开发教程与功能介绍
- Cookies by lfj.io: 浏览数据智能管理与同步工具
- 掌握SSH框架与SpringMVC Hibernate集成教程
- C语言实现FFT算法及互相关性能优化指南